Modern product science has actually significantly improved the effectiveness and safety of these protective installations. The out-of-date, highly poisonous chemicals of previous generations have actually been changed by advanced, non repellent liquid treatments. When foraging pests experience this modern chemical zone, they can not detect its presence, meaning they do not prevent it. Rather, they walk through the treated zone, accidentally getting the microscopic active ingredients on their bodies and transferring them back to the main nest through grooming habits. This domino effect effectively reduces the effects of the whole nest, including the queen, offering an elite level of security that basic physical barriers alone can not match.

To guarantee the long term efficiency of a recently installed protective system, property owners need to maintain clear inspection zones around the external walls. Basic practices such as avoiding garden beds or without treatment timber mulch from covering the edge of the barrier, guaranteeing warm water system overflow lines drain away from the slab, and rapidly fixing dripping outdoor taps will considerably boost the durability of the system. Regular annual inspections by certified experts match the barrier, validating that the dealt with zones have actually not been inadvertently bridged or disrupted by subsequent landscaping work or building modifications.
